Output 96fc5a4bf16c4f05f7378eea823bd6e6d3381f4b43410d84186e48f76e6c4443:0

value
3589177
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7fe2524bf158a802f30a239fe760b6c4848c43ba OP_EQUAL
address
3DMCrzpbCM3VgvBYdt5586iZdpDcfT3TwG
transaction
96fc5a4bf16c4f05f7378eea823bd6e6d3381f4b43410d84186e48f76e6c4443
confirmations
142465
spent
true